Origins of Gambling and Early Casinos

The concept of gambling dates back thousands of years, with evidence found in ancient civilizations such as Mesopotamia, China, and Egypt. These early forms of gambling included dice games and betting on the outcomes of various events. As societies evolved, so did the complexity of gambling activities. The term “casino” itself is derived from the Italian word for “little house,” reflecting the small, intimate settings where people gathered to play games. By the late 1600s, these establishments began to flourish, particularly in Venice, where they attracted the elite and created a unique culture around gaming and entertainment.

The Rise of Gambling in Europe

Throughout the 18th century, gambling became increasingly popular across Europe, leading to the establishment of grand casinos in cities like Paris and Monte Carlo. These lavish venues offered a variety of games, including roulette and baccarat, which became staples in the casino world. The allure of these establishments was not just in the games themselves, but also in the luxurious atmosphere and the social opportunities they provided.

As gambling gained prominence, so did the need for regulation. By the 19th century, governments began to impose rules on gaming houses to combat cheating and fraud. This led to the creation of official licensing systems and the establishment of fair play standards, which further legitimized the casino industry and attracted a more diverse clientele.

Casino Culture in the United States

The introduction of casinos in the United States can be traced back to the early 19th century, with the first official casino, the “Gambling Saloon,” opening in New Orleans. This marked the beginning of a unique gaming culture that would evolve over the decades. The Gold Rush era saw an explosion of gambling establishments across the West, as prospectors sought entertainment and fortune.

However, it was Las Vegas that would become the epicenter of casino culture in the mid-20th century. The legalization of gambling in Nevada in 1931 paved the way for the construction of extravagant resorts and casinos, attracting visitors from all over the world. The glitz and glamour of Vegas became synonymous with the idea of modern casinos, setting trends that would influence gaming globally.

Modern Casinos and Technology

The advent of technology has significantly transformed the casino industry in recent years. The introduction of electronic gaming machines, online casinos, and mobile gaming applications has revolutionized how people engage with gambling. Players can now access a wide range of games from the comfort of their homes, leading to a surge in online gambling popularity.

Moreover, advancements in virtual reality and artificial intelligence are paving the way for immersive gaming experiences that were previously unimaginable. These technologies not only enhance player engagement but also help operators provide personalized services, further changing the landscape of modern casinos.
